按类别查询搜索结果
关于关键词 的检测结果,共 2282
erqw321 | 2012-12-20 15:01:59 | 阅读(861) | 评论(0)
Android开发以Java作为基础语言,需要对整体构架进行研究并完成代码的编写和测试。为基于Android应用软件开发的简单过程,在智能手机端建立远程视频播放的应用程序,布局文件layout对用户界面进行设计和布局,sre目录下完威Java主程序的编写,各个代码之间通过Intent连接最终实现客户端用户和服务器的数据通信,搭建Android开发4.2 src扳程序开发在整个项目中,sre目录下的lava主程序占主导位置, 由布局文件声明的对象会在gen目录下的Rjava中自动生成相应的编号ID,Android应用程序通过R类实现对资源的应用。因此,在Java主程序中需要通过findVi【阅读全文】
sdsdfs1111 | 2012-12-20 10:03:41 | 阅读(1269) | 评论(0)
3G手机无疑引爆了Android开发平台的应用,与此同时Android软件开发工程师也成为了炙手可热的职位。越来越多的IT从业者开始进军Android软件开发行业,由于android开发平台的范围太广,所以学习Android软件开发并非那么容易。对此,下面为大家推荐一个很好的Android软件开发学习之路。 整个的学习过程分为5个阶段: 第一阶段:Java SE 编程 第二阶段:Android 基础应用开发 第三阶段:Android 核心组件开发 第四阶段:Android 深入开发 第五阶段:Android 综合项目实战   第一阶段:【阅读全文】
landuochong | 2012-12-20 09:47:32 | 阅读(2561) | 评论(0)
10.6  蓝牙的基本介绍与实现(1)蓝牙,是一种支持设备短距离通信(一般10m内,且无阻隔媒介)的无线电技术。能在包括移动电话、PDA、无线耳机、笔记本电脑等众多设备之间进行无线信息交换。利用"蓝牙"技术,能够有效地简化移动通信终端设备之间的通信,也能够成功地简化设备与Internet之间的通信,这样数据传输变得更加迅速高效,为无线通信拓宽道路。几个术语在Android手机平台中,只到Android 2.0才引入蓝牙接口。在开发时,需要真机测试,如果需要数据传输,还需要两台机器,另外蓝牙需要硬件支持,但一般的智能手机上都会有这方面的支持,特别是Android系统的手机。正【阅读全文】
【嵌入式】 Android之NDK编码转
myfaxmail | 2012-12-19 23:25:13 | 阅读(4386) | 评论(0)
基于NDK下的编码转换,当然是直接调用C/C++下的实现效率更高,下面介绍2种方案(不建议通过JNI调用JAVA的实现,尽管这样也能实现编码的转换)。 1. 采用Android系统自带的libicuuc.so库 2. 采用第三方编码转换库libiconv,源码链接:http://ftp.gnu.org/pub/gnu/libiconv/libiconv的使用有3个函数:a) iconv_t iconv_open (const char* tocode, const char* fromcode);b) size_t iconv (iconv_【阅读全文】
wenkudaren | 2012-12-19 11:02:59 | 阅读(1264) | 评论(0)
  【收藏吗】Android应用-用户图形界面设计概念    软件图形界面(GraphicInterface)是二十世纪最重要的创造发明之一,它为数字化普及革命所带来的巨大贡献是软件领域中其它任何发明所不能媲美的。图形界面的出现直接带来了人们生活方式的变革。图形界面的发展可以追溯20世纪六十年代,随后经历了20世纪六十年代和七十年代的萌芽阶段和二十世纪八十年代至今的发展阶段。到图形界面综合了人机工程学、认知心理学、艺术设计学、语文学、社会学众多学科领域的知识,已经发展成为一门独立的学科。  在计算机出现半个世纪的时间里,图形界面经过不断完善,逐步成熟,逐渐从命令语言界面转变【阅读全文】
leihuiok | 2012-12-18 14:14:35 | 阅读(1812) | 评论(0)
Handler通过接收Message 发送过来的常量值改变view状态,view调用的是invalidate()方法 触发了 onDraw()方法,在onDraw()方法里面设置了view的移动值。                       下面是java 代码       package com.hander.com;import android.app.Activity;import android.conte【阅读全文】
wenkudaren | 2012-12-18 11:27:01 | 阅读(990) | 评论(0)
Android应用开发笔记(1)调用打电话和发短信、收短信接口、发Email 打电话和发短信可以说是最核心的应用了,本文就来阐述它的调用方法。可以分为直接调用--直接电话或短信发出,已经间接调用--进入拨号或短信撰写页面,等待用户确认内容后由用户发出.先看代码效果截图:先编写主界面Activaty,创建类CallAndSms作为为默认启动页[java] view plaincopy1.  package jtapp.callandsms;  2.    3.  import&【阅读全文】
leihuiok | 2012-12-17 13:53:31 | 阅读(2208) | 评论(0)
    做android开发有段时间了,于是决定开博写点东西,提高技术,交点朋友。我决定从零开始写android,毕竟学到的知识有限,首先来说说android开发环境搭建,环境搭建大同小异,下面是一般环境搭建的全过程(原文转自吴秦)。 本系列适合零基础的人员,因为我就是从零开始的,此系列记录我步入Android开发的一些经验分享,望与君共勉!作为Android队伍中的一个新人的我,如果有什么不对的地方,还望不吝赐教。 在开始Android开发之旅启动之前,首先要搭建环境,然后创建一个简单的HelloWorld。本文的主题如下: 1、环境搭建 【阅读全文】
escarp | 2012-12-17 13:17:53 | 阅读(3512) | 评论(0)
地址:http://www.crystax.net/?locale=en这个CrystaX NDK的作者是俄罗斯人,牛逼!俄罗斯,一个黑客云集的地方。这个是NDK r7的新特性介绍:DescriptionHere is customized distribution of Android NDK r7 which I have rebuilt from official sources. Starting from NDK r5, Google added support of C++ exceptions, RTTI and STL to the official NDK. That's g【阅读全文】
【嵌入式】 最新Android 面试题
lihang4216137 | 2012-12-17 09:35:27 | 阅读(795) | 评论(0)
    最新Android 面试题        1、Android本身的API并未声明会抛弃异常,则其在运行时有无可能抛出runtime异常,你遇到过吗?诺有的话会导致什么问题?如何解决?        2、IntentService有何优点?        3、如果后台的Activity由于某原因被系统回收了,如何在被系统回收之前保存当前状态? &【阅读全文】
txgc_wm | 2012-12-15 15:54:02 | 阅读(1672) | 评论(0)
       通过 AirDroid 这个 Android 应用,你只要在任何网络浏览器(如 Firefox 或 Chrome)中便可对 Android 设备进行轻松管理,从此摆脱线缆的羁绊。        除了能够传输各种文件之外,AirDroid 还允许你整理音乐、照片、视频(当然你也可以播放或查看它们),发送或备份短信,安装或删除应用,查看设备状态,以及进程活动等信息。        一旦在【阅读全文】
lihang4216137 | 2012-12-14 09:57:17 | 阅读(820) | 评论(0)
       Android与HTML5融合1、Android的HTML5应用程序概述2、如何适配多分辨率的Android设备?3、如何在Android中构建HTML5应用程序?4、如何在Android中调试HTML5应用程序?5、如何在Android中使用HTML5的本地存储?6、如何在Android中使用HTML5的本地数据库?7、如何在Android中使用HTML5的地理定位?8、如何在Android中构建HTML5离线应用?9、如何使用Canvas进行绘图?       【阅读全文】
wenkudaren | 2012-12-13 11:58:42 | 阅读(976) | 评论(0)
编写一个基本的Android应用程序本文展示如何构建一个 Android 应用程序。示例应用程序非常简单:一个修改后的 “Hello Android” 应用程序。您将进行一个微小的修改,使屏幕背景全部变为白色,以便把手机用作手电筒。这个例子不是很有创意,但是可以作为一个有用的例子。请 下载 完整的源代码。为了在 Eclipse 中创建应用程序,选择 File > New > Android project,这将启动 New Android Project 向导。图 1. New An【阅读全文】
escarp | 2012-12-12 21:42:23 | 阅读(11479) | 评论(1)
估计是Eclipse ADT插件的bug,导入android工程时有时候会提示这个错误:按照提示,说是当前的工作空间内已经有同名的工程了,但实际是没有的。。。多次碰到这种问题后,无意间找到解决办法。。。不要选择导入android工程,而是General工程。。上图!【阅读全文】
lihang4216137 | 2012-12-12 09:06:09 | 阅读(926) | 评论(0)
             重点:Android Google Map API              MapActivity              MapView控件   &【阅读全文】
escarp | 2012-12-11 13:27:15 | 阅读(3631) | 评论(0)
[android NDK]1, error: unknown type name 'class'原因:定义类的实现方法所在的问题的后缀名不是*.cpp解决方法:将.c改成.cpp【阅读全文】
escarp | 2012-12-10 14:45:57 | 阅读(6535) | 评论(0)
原文:http://blog.csdn.net/jhg19900321/article/details/7375924今天由于项目需要,需要在Ubuntu环境下配置NDK,一开始以为蛮简单的,没想到还是遇到了一些问题,在这里和大家一起分享下,也希望以后遇到相同问题的朋友可以少绕弯子。     首先到   下下载NDK文件     解压缩到home文件下,例如:     /home/jhg/android/android-ndk-r6b/     添加路径 【阅读全文】
escarp | 2012-12-10 14:11:35 | 阅读(1769) | 评论(0)
对于Linux我也是一位新人,弄Linux也就半年左右吧,同时作为Android队伍中的一个新人。 由于我最近每天使用的是CentOS 5.5,所以选择CentOS5.5作为我的开发环境。 我以前一直在LinuxSir潜水,第一次发贴,我还是细致的把我作的写下来。同时作为我的学习笔记我会把我的学习成果发上来的。 作为新人,如果有什么不对的地方,还望各位不吝赐教,多多关照~ 目录 1、环境搭建   1.1、JDK安装   1.2、Eclipse安装   1.3、ADT安装   1.4、Android SDK【阅读全文】
landuochong | 2012-12-10 11:21:46 | 阅读(1283) | 评论(0)
信息的接收工作是由底层来完成的,当有一个 新的信息时底层完成接收后会以Intent的方式来通知上层应用,信息的相关内容也包含在Intent当中,Android所支持的信息Intent都定 义在android.provider.Telephony.Intents里面。 短信的接收 短信接收,对于上层应用程序来讲就是要处理广播事件 SMS_RECEIVED_ACTION,它是由Frameworks发出告诉上层有新的SMS已收到。在Mms中,是由 PrivilegedSmsReceiver来处理,它收到 SMS_RECEIVED_ACTION(android.prov【阅读全文】
landuochong | 2012-12-10 11:20:58 | 阅读(1311) | 评论(0)
从软件的功能角度来讲,Mms分为对话列表,消息列表,短信编辑,彩信编辑,短信显示,彩信显示和配置。 从实现的角度来看,它分为GUI展示层,发送/接收,彩信解析,彩信附件,信息数据等,这些分类对应着源码中的各种包。 源码导航 Mms的源码的位置在于android/packages/apps/Mms 其中Mms/src/com/android/mms里面都是Mms相关的代码,而Mms/src/org/w3c/dom里面是一个类库,主要用于彩信格式的解析和显示。这里主要讲一下Mms/src/com/android/mms下面的一些包和类的主要用途。 ui---GUI展示层,用于展示对话【阅读全文】